Not only was it the best match of the year in WWE, but it was the match of the year, period, that being Shawn Michaels vs The Undertaker in Shawn's retirement match.

it felt like it just picked up where last year's match left off. Both men kicked out of each other's finishers once again, and the storytelling within the match was second to none. you can take all your flips and flops, Ill take a match that tells a great story. This match did exactly that, especially with the finishing sequence.

Taker shows mercy, Michaels shows his trademark defiance by mocking Taker and slapping him, and an angry Taker hits a jumping tombstone. I thought it was every bit as good as their match the year before, so it's easily the WWE match of the year for me.

Taker vs. HBK II at WM26 is, overall, probably the best WWE match of 2010. I don't think the action was quite as good as it was at WM25 because everyone was blown away by how good that match was. It'd been over a decade since they'd last wrestled and while everyone was expecting a very good match, any possible expectation they had was shattered. This year, people were expecting a fantastic match and they got it and they knew what to expect overall. However, the emotional content of the match and the story it told was much higher and I think was able to make it the equal of WM25.

Wade Barrett vs John Cena - Hell in a Cell PPV

I can't say enough good things about this match. This was Wade Barrett's first 20 minute match on WWE television, and I don't think anyone could ask for more. The action flowed like a hot knife through better. Barrett's offense mostly came from him using his strength to counter Cena. Cena's offense was mostly out of desperation...

..Which lead to the biggest reason this match kicked everyone's ass: It had such "pro wrestling" drama to it. Most people who weren't jaded to any guy and watched this match will admit that they were sitting on their edge of their seats. No one know who the hell was going to win this one because the near falls were incredible. Wade started to look really concerned that he would lose the match after Cena barely kicked out of The Wasteland; Barrett kicking out of a fucking AA was something to behold. And when Wade won, it was completely and utterly shocking to everyone who watched.
